The Anatomy of Permanent Deletion: Logical vs. Physical

To understand how to recover a file, you must first understand what “deleted” means to your computer. When you simply move a file to the Recycle Bin, Windows 10 merely changes the file’s location pointer and marks it for potential deletion. The file is easily restored because it’s still fully intact and indexed within a protected directory.

When you permanently delete a file (by pressing Shift+Delete, or emptying the Recycle Bin), Windows 10 takes a different approach. The reference pointer in the Master File Table (MFT) or similar indexing structure is removed, and the space occupied by the file’s data blocks on the physical drive is marked as available for new data. Critically, the data itself remains on the drive until another piece of data overwrites it. This period between logical deletion and physical overwriting is the crucial window for recovery.

On traditional hard disk drives (HDDs), this window might last for days or weeks, depending on how frequently the disk space is used. However, on modern SSDs, which utilize a feature called TRIM, the process is accelerated. TRIM automatically zeroes out the data blocks shortly after logical deletion to prepare the space for future writes, significantly reducing wear on the drive and increasing performance. This means a file permanently deleted on an SSD often becomes truly unrecoverable without highly advanced, specialized (and often costly) data recovery services that analyze the drive’s internal components.

Therefore, “without software” recovery in Windows 10 primarily depends on the following built-in mechanisms:

  1. File History: A robust backup feature designed for personal files.
  2. Previous Versions (Volume Shadow Copy Service): A snapshot feature that creates automatic copies of files and folders at specific time intervals (often during System Restore points).
  3. Cloud Integration: Using native integrations like OneDrive, which maintains its own Recycle Bin.

Let’s explore each of these powerful methods in detail.

Method 1: The Primary Defense – Recovering from File History

File History is arguably the most powerful native recovery tool in Windows 10 for user data (documents, pictures, music, videos). It works by continuously backing up files from designated libraries (Desktop, Documents, Downloads, etc.) to an external drive or network location. If you have File History enabled, recovering a permanently deleted file is straightforward.

Understanding File History Configuration

The critical requirement for this method to work is that File History must have been enabled before the deletion occurred. If it was not enabled, this method will not work for the permanently deleted file, but it serves as a crucial lesson for future data protection.

To verify if File History is active or to configure it for future use:

  1. Navigate to the Windows Search bar and type “File History settings.”
  2. In the File History settings window, ensure that File History is set to “On” and that a drive is selected for storing the backups. The system requires an external hard drive, USB drive, or network location; it cannot back up to the same physical drive where the original files reside.
  3. Ensure the “Back up these folders” list includes the location where your file was stored. Windows 10 defaults to common locations like Desktop, Documents, Pictures, etc., but you may need to add custom folders if necessary.

Step-by-Step Recovery using File History

If File History was properly configured, here is how to recover the deleted file:

  1. Open the folder where the file used to reside before it was permanently deleted from the Recycle Bin. For instance, if you deleted a document named “ProjectProposal.docx” from your “Documents” folder, open the Documents folder.
  2. In the file explorer, navigate to the “Home” tab on the ribbon at the top of the window.
  3. Look for the “History” button. Clicking this button opens the File History interface.
  4. The File History interface displays a timeline of all previous versions of the files in that specific folder. Use the left and right arrows to navigate through different backup snapshots in time, going back to a date when you know the deleted file existed.
  5. Once you locate the desired file (or folder containing the file) in the interface, select it.
  6. Click the green “Restore” button (usually shaped like a curved arrow) to recover the file. Windows 10 will automatically restore the file to its original location. If a file with the same name already exists in that location, you will be prompted to replace it, keep both copies, or skip restoring.

Advanced File History Recovery Considerations

If you cannot locate the file in the specific folder where it was deleted, or if the “History” button is unavailable, try searching a different way:

  1. Go directly to the File History control panel (by searching “File History” in Windows search).
  2. Select “Restore personal files.” This opens a general browser view of all File History backups.
  3. Use the search function within this window or manually navigate through the backed-up directories to find the file.

The success of File History relies entirely on consistent backups. If you recently deleted the file, ensure your backup drive is connected and the latest backup run completed successfully.

Method 2: The Silent Saver – Previous Versions (Volume Shadow Copy Service)

The “Previous Versions” feature, also known as Volume Shadow Copy Service (VSS), is a powerful tool often overlooked by users. Unlike File History, which requires an external drive, Previous Versions takes snapshots of files and folders on your main drive. These snapshots are typically created automatically during System Restore points or as part of a System Image Backup.

Understanding VSS Configuration

Previous Versions relies on System Protection being active for the drive where the files were located. To check if System Protection is enabled:

  1. Search for “System Protection” or “Create a restore point” in the Windows search bar.
  2. In the “System Properties” window, navigate to the “System Protection” tab.
  3. Check the “Protection” status for your local drives (C: drive, D: drive, etc.). The protection status must be set to “On” for the drive containing the deleted file.

If System Protection is set to “On,” the operating system automatically creates copies of files whenever a restore point is created. If you do not have System Restore enabled, you must enable it for this method to work for future deletions.

Step-by-Step Recovery using Previous Versions

If System Protection was properly configured, follow these steps to recover the deleted file:

  1. Navigate to the folder where the file used to be located.
  2. Right-click on the folder (not the empty space inside it) and select “Properties.”
  3. In the Properties window, select the “Previous Versions” tab.
  4. Windows 10 will list all available snapshots of that folder at different dates and times.
  5. Look for a version of the folder that predates the permanent deletion of the file. Select that version and click either “Restore” or “Open.”
  6. If you click “Open,” you can manually browse the contents of the folder snapshot, locate the permanently deleted file, and copy it back to its original (or any other) location. If you click “Restore,” it replaces the current version of the folder with the selected previous version, which might overwrite existing changes to other files in that folder since the snapshot was taken.

Critical Note on Previous Versions and System Restore

While related, it is crucial to understand the difference between Previous Versions and a full System Restore. System Restore primarily focuses on recovering system files, settings, and registry changes. Performing a System Restore will not recover user files (documents, pictures, videos) that were deleted. System Restore’s value here is that it generates the system snapshots that contain the Previous Versions of user files.

Method 3: The Cloud Solution – Recovering from OneDrive or Other Cloud Storage

In the context of modern Windows 10 usage, a “without software” solution includes integrated cloud services. If you utilize Microsoft OneDrive (which is integrated into the operating system) or other services like Google Drive or Dropbox, you have a powerful additional layer of protection against permanent deletion.

OneDrive Recycle Bin and Version History

OneDrive operates independently from the local Windows Recycle Bin. When a file is deleted from a folder synced with OneDrive, the file is moved to the OneDrive Recycle Bin, which exists in the cloud. Even if you completely empty your local Recycle Bin, the file remains in the cloud-based Recycle Bin for a specified period (usually 30 days) before being permanently removed from OneDrive.

Step-by-Step Recovery using OneDrive

  1. Open your web browser and navigate to the OneDrive website (onedrive.live.com) and sign in with your Microsoft account.
  2. Look for the “Recycle Bin” option in the left-hand navigation pane.
  3. Browse the items in the Recycle Bin. If the file was synced with OneDrive, it should appear here.
  4. Select the file and choose “Restore” to move it back to its original synced folder on your PC.

Advanced OneDrive Feature: Version History

OneDrive also includes version history for files, similar to File History. If you deleted an older version of a file and only want to recover the most recent copy, this feature is less relevant. However, if you edited and saved a file repeatedly, and then permanently deleted it, you can potentially recover any of its previous versions from OneDrive’s version history. Right-click on a file in the OneDrive web interface and select “Version history” to see available versions.

Advanced Concepts and Alternative Native Tools

While the above methods are the primary solutions, there are other built-in Windows features that may be relevant, depending on the circumstances of the file loss.

1. Using Windows Backup and Restore (Windows 7 Legacy Tool)

Windows 10 still includes a legacy tool called “Backup and Restore (Windows 7).” While often superseded by File History, some users still rely on it for full system image backups. If you previously configured a system image backup using this tool, you may be able to browse the backup image for a copy of the deleted file.

Step-by-Step Recovery using Backup and Restore:

  1. Search for “Backup settings” and select “Go to Backup and Restore (Windows 7).”
  2. Ensure your external backup drive is connected.
  3. Follow the prompts to restore files from the existing backup image.

2. The Command Line and CHKDSK

Some online guides suggest using command line tools like CHKDSK to recover deleted files. This advice is often misleading for permanently deleted files. The CHKDSK (Check Disk) utility is designed to scan the file system on a disk for errors and try to repair them. While it can recover lost data fragments or fix files that have become corrupted due to disk errors, it is not a data recovery tool specifically for files deleted from the Recycle Bin. Running CHKDSK on a drive where data was recently deleted may, in fact, cause further overwriting or corruption of the blocks where the deleted file resides, reducing the chances of later recovery.

Therefore, using CHKDSK as a primary recovery method for permanently deleted files is generally ineffective and potentially counterproductive.

The Critical Takeaway: Prevention Over Reaction

The “without software” constraint for recovering permanently deleted files highlights a critical truth in data management: prevention is vastly more effective than reactive recovery. The success of recovering a permanently deleted file depends almost entirely on whether you had a backup or system protection feature enabled before the deletion occurred.

The “Do Not Use” Rule and Data Overwriting

If you have permanently deleted a file and lack a configured backup solution, the most important action you can take immediately is to stop using the hard drive or SSD where the file was located. Every minute you use the computer, download new files, or even browse the internet, you increase the risk that the operating system will overwrite the data blocks containing the permanently deleted file. If you are serious about recovering the file, the best solution (if built-in methods fail) is to shut down the computer immediately and seek professional data recovery services.

However, since this guide focuses on the “without software” constraint, we must conclude that if the built-in methods (File History, Previous Versions, OneDrive) fail to locate a copy, the file is highly likely to be unrecoverable through native means.

Summary of Best Practices for Future Data Protection:

  1. Activate File History: Ensure File History is configured and regularly backing up your personal files to an external drive or network location.
  2. Activate Previous Versions (VSS): Confirm that System Protection is enabled for your main drive, providing system snapshots that allow access to previous versions of your files.
  3. Utilize Cloud Storage: If using OneDrive, ensure critical folders are synced, providing an off-site backup and version history.
  4. Create System Image Backups: Periodically create full system image backups using Windows Backup and Restore. While primarily for system recovery, these images contain snapshots of user data.

By implementing these preventive measures, you transform “permanent deletion” from a catastrophe into a minor inconvenience, ensuring that a simple “without software” restore from a previous version is always a viable solution. The power to recover permanently deleted files lies not in reactive measures after the fact, but in the proactive establishment of a robust backup ecosystem within Windows 10.
